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Newtonsville Apartments

How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Newtonsville Apartment?

The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Newtonsville is $1,427.

What is the largest Pet Friendly Newtonsville Apartment for rent?

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Newtonsville is a 1,455 square feet unit starting from $1,500 at Loveland Station Apartments.

What is the average size for Newtonsville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Newtonsville is currently at 794 sq ft.
